I.T.S Dental College, Greater Noida was established in the year 2006. The college is a self-financed institution, recognized by the Dental Council of India, Ministry of Health & Family Welfare and is affiliated to Ch. Charan Singh University, Meerut. I.T.S Dental College, Greater Noida ranks among the top 3 private dental colleges in Delhi-NCR & among the top 5 in North India. 

ITSDC offers a five year Bachelor of Dental Surgery (B.D.S) with an intake of 100 students per batch and three year Master of Dental Surgery (M.D.S) Programme under 6 specializations.

To be eligible for admission to the BDS program, the candidates must possess a 10+2 qualification in PCM with a minimum of 50% marks. The basic eligibility required for admission to the MDS program is a BDS degree with a Rotatory Internship.

Admissions are done through a single Common Entrance Test called National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ET-UG/MDS) conducted by CBSE and National Board of Examinations (NBE) respectively.

For the purpose of registration to the UG (BDS), Post-graduate Medical Admissions (MDS) courses provided at I.T.S Dental College, the candidates must apply through NEET-UG and NEET-MDS.

I.T.S Dental College Greater Noida BDS Eligibility Criteria

  • The candidate should have passed 10+2 before 1st October of the year of admission and must have scored a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ate of Physics, Chemistry, and Biology. 
  • Also, the candidate should qualify NEET BDS as per the guidelines of Hon’ble Supreme Court of India
  • The candidate should be 17 years old on or before 31st December of the year of admission.

I.T.S Dental College Greater Noida BDS Selection Criteria

Admission to BDS Courses at ITS Dental College is done through a single Common Entrance test called National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ET-UG) conducted by the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E).

I.T.S Dental College Greater Noida MDS Eligibility Criteria

  • The candidate should have passed a Bachelor of Dental Surgery (BDS) and completed a Rotatory Internship from Dental college affiliated with DCI on or before 31st March of the year of admissions to the MDS course.
  • He/She should be registered with any State Dental Council.
  • The candidate must qualify NEET MDS as per the guidelines of Hon’ble Supreme Court of India for application in this course.

Selection Criteria

Admissions are done through a single Common Entrance test called National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ET-MDS) conducted by the National Board of Examinations (NBE).

FAQs

Ques. Who is eligible for NEET-UG 15% All India Quota Counseling?

Ans. All candidates who have qualified for All India Quota seats on the basis of their rank in NEET UG conducted by the Central Board of Secondary Education (NTA) except J&K are eligible. Eligible candidates may download the Rank letter/ Result from the NTA website. The cutoff rank of eligible candidates is also available on this website under the heading of notice.

Ques. What documents are required at the time of online counseling?

Ans. Since it is an online allotment (Online Counseling) process, no documents will be required for participating in the online allotment process during the Registration process.

Ques. Is it necessary to join allotted Dental College of Round 1 to get a chance to participate in Round 2?

Ans. No candidates need not report or join the allotted college of Round 1 since there is a free exit. However, if they want to hold the Round 1 seat they can join the college of Round 1 and give up-gradation willingness for Second Round.

Ques. Who is eligible for Deemed Universities Counseling?

Ans. All candidates who have qualified for All India Quota seats based on their rank in NEET UG conducted by the NTA. Including candidates from J&K.
